Title: Re: Did Elite keyboards warehouse burn down?
Post by: intelli78 on Mon, 12 November 2018, 12:29:41
I think it's pretty much out of business. For a long time they were the exclusive seller of HHKBs and Realforces in the USA, but that deal has clearly fallen apart and unfortunately they didn't keep up with the competition. :(
